The disposal of electronic equipment is governed by a series of rules aimed at guaranteeing environmental protection and public health. Of particular note is the National Solid Waste Policy (PNRS), instituted by Law No. 12.305/2010, which establishes shared responsibility for the life cycle of electronic products.
The PNRS determines that electronic waste must be disposed of in an environmentally appropriate manner, avoiding contamination of soil, water and air. In addition, CONAMA Resolution No. 401/2008 establishes criteria for the management of solid waste, including electronic components.
Another important point is compliance with the specific rules of federal and state bodies, such as CETESB (Environmental Company of the State of São Paulo), which controls correct disposal and environmental certifications.
For safe disposal, it is recommended that equipment be sent to specialized services that promote professional e-waste collection. This practice ensures compliance with environmental standards and proper segregation of hazardous and recyclable materials.
When it comes to storage media, such as hard disks, information security is paramount. That's why safe hard drive sanitization is essential in the process, preventing sensitive data from leaking and complying with current regulations.
According to Law No. 12.305/2010, electronic waste generators are obliged to dispose of it correctly or hire services that comply with environmental legislation. Failure to comply can result in administrative sanctions, fines and civil liability.
It is essential to keep records of disposal, proving the environmentally appropriate destination of equipment. This ensures transparency in audits and any inspections, helping to comply with the legal requirements implemented by the National Solid Waste Management Information System (SINIR).
Complying with environmental legislation when disposing of equipment requires knowledge of the rules in force, partnerships with specialized providers and compliance with legal obligations. Adopting these practices preserves the environment and mitigates legal and environmental risks.
